Tyre Wear Patterns
Tyre wear patterns refer to the way a tyre's tread surface wears down over time. Rather than wearing evenly across the full width of the tread, tyres sometimes develop distinct patterns of wear — on the edges, in the center, or in irregular patches. These patterns are not random; they reflect how the tyre is making contact with the road, which in turn reveals information about tyre pressure, wheel alignment, suspension condition, and driving habits.
Tread depth is measured in 32nds of an inch in the U.S.; the legal minimum is typically 2/32", though many safety experts recommend replacement at 4/32" for improved wet-road braking.

The Most Common Tyre Wear Patterns Explained
Centre Tread Wear
When the centre of the tyre wears faster than the edges, over-inflation is usually the cause. An over-inflated tyre bulges slightly in the middle, putting more contact pressure on the central tread band and lifting the edges away from the road surface. The fix is straightforward: check and correct tyre pressure to the vehicle manufacturer's specification, found on the sticker inside the driver's door jamb.
Edge-to-Edge Wear (Both Shoulders)
When both outer edges of a tyre wear faster than the centre, the tyre has been consistently under-inflated. A soft tyre flexes excessively, pushing more contact area onto the shoulders. Beyond accelerated wear, under-inflation generates heat and can compromise tyre structure over time. Checking tyre pressure monthly — and before long trips — addresses this pattern at its source.
One-Sided or Inner/Outer Edge Wear
Wear concentrated on just one side of a tyre — either the inner or outer edge — almost always indicates a wheel alignment problem. Specifically, it points to an incorrect camber angle. Negative camber (top of wheel tilted inward) causes inner edge wear; positive camber causes outer edge wear. Suspension component wear, such as deteriorating ball joints or control arm bushings, can also produce this pattern.
Check Tyre Pressure When Tyres Are Cold
Tyre pressure readings are most accurate when the tyres are cold — meaning the vehicle has been parked for at least three hours and driven fewer than a mile. Heat from driving increases pressure temporarily, which can lead to inaccurate readings. Always compare your reading against the manufacturer's recommended PSI found on the driver's door jamb sticker, not the maximum pressure listed on the tyre sidewall.
Cupping or Scalloping
Cupping appears as a series of high and low spots around the tyre tread, creating a wavy or scooped surface. This rhythmic pattern is typically caused by worn or failing shock absorbers or struts that allow the tyre to bounce unevenly against the road. It may also result from an out-of-balance tyre or wheel. Cupped tyres often produce a rumbling noise at highway speed.
Patchy or Flat Spot Wear
Flat spots in isolated areas of the tread usually result from hard braking events that caused the tyre to slide rather than roll — common in vehicles without ABS. They can also develop if a vehicle sits stationary for extended periods under load, causing the tyre to develop a temporary flat-contact deformation.
What to Do When You Spot Abnormal Wear
Identifying a wear pattern is only the first step. The critical action is addressing the root cause — replacing a tyre without fixing the underlying issue will simply wear out the new tyre in the same pattern.
If you observe any of the patterns described above, have a qualified mechanic inspect the vehicle. An alignment check, suspension inspection, and tyre pressure assessment are all relatively low-cost services that can prevent far more expensive repairs down the road. Tyre rotation on a regular schedule — typically every 5,000 to 7,500 miles — remains one of the most effective ways to promote even wear across all four tyres.
